Entreprendre (ALENR) has a Long-term Investment Intensity of 3.5% as of June 2018. Long-term investments of €315.71K represent 3.5% of total assets of €9.04 Million. A higher ratio indicates a company with significant capital committed to long-duration strategic positions. Annual Long-term Investment Intensity for Entreprendre (2013–2017)

The table below presents the year-by-year Long-term Investment Intensity for Entreprendre from 2013 to 2017, covering 5 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, long-term investments, the intensity perc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. Year LT Investment Intensity LT Investments (EUR) Total Assets Change (pp)
2017 5.1% €495.48K €9.63 Million ▼ -3.3 pp
2016 8.5% €917.88K €10.84 Million ▼ -3.8 pp
2015 12.3% €1.46 Million €11.86 Million ▼ -2.2 pp
2014 14.5% €1.73 Million €11.92 Million ▲ +8.7 pp
2013 5.8% €639.56K €10.93 Million
pp = percentage points
